day three-hundred-and-thirty-five - flowerhorn fish

man there are some weird fish on this planet

© jem barratt

there are all kinds of flowerhorn fishies, rainbow ones, splotchy ones, and ones with lots o spots.

but don't get too attached - they are man-made hybrids and thus not found in nature and thus thus probably a cruel creation. indeed, they are susceptible to 'hole-in-head disease'. someone really could have named that better, come on.
